Join our dynamic CLM team as a KYC & Onboarding Specialist and become a trusted partner to our Private Banking clients. Collaborate with Relationship Managers, Compliance, and Legal experts to solve complex challenges and deliver best-in-class client experiences.
At the heart of a global financial institution, you'll analyze client structures and help safeguard our clients' success. Your expertise will directly impact how we serve clients across borders, making you an essential part of a diverse, high-performing team that values innovation, integrity, and continuous learning.

This is a full-time, on-site role, working Monday to Friday from 9:00 a.m. to 6:00 p.m.

Responsibilities
* Perform detailed reviews of client documentation and KYC information; identify and escalate potential compliance risks.
* Analyze complex client and ownership structures and provide clear feedback on onboarding/KYC/documentation review outcomes.
* Advise Front Office through account opening and KYC review.
* Coordinate with Relationship Managers, Compliance, and Legal to remove blockers and improve end-to-end CLM efficiency.
* Track cases, follow up on progress, and produce regular reporting with defined improvement actions.
* Take on further responsibilities depending on personal job development and the evolution and needs of the team.

Skills
* 2+ years in Client Lifecycle Management/KYC within Private Banking, with strong knowledge of KYC standards and banking documentation and regulations.
* Good analytical skills to assess and interpret complex client structures.
* Solid understanding of private banking products, services and international regulatory requirements.
* Good problem-solving skills, multitasking, attention to detail and accuracy, with strong teamwork and organisational skills, with ability to work under strict deadlines.
* Excellent spoken and written English; additional languages (e.g., French, German, Italian, Norwegian, Swedish, Spanish) are a strong advantage.
* Good working knowledge of basic Microsoft tools (Excel, Word, Power Point). Working knowledge of Avaloq is a plus.
